Take it all with a grain of salt, the King Box, Blues Box, BB Box are all slang terms that loosely translate to pent shapes, where in fact its more about the sound of the music use. The BB sound is smiling blues and Albert King is frowning blues. the BB sound is Major pent over the major chord (A Maj pent over A7) and the Albert sound is min pent over Major chord (A minor pent over A7). Albert King didn't even play in standard tuning so the shape thing is out the window anyways.
